How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sherwood Forest?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sherwood Forest Studio Apartments | $1,070 | $650 | $1,486 |
| Sherwood Forest 1 Bedroom Apartments | $959 | $694 | $1,745 |
| Sherwood Forest 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,097 | $750 | $2,129 |
| Sherwood Forest 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,282 | $1,046 | $1,900 |
| Sherwood Forest 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,394 | $1,200 | $1,499 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Sherwood Forest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Sherwood Forest?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Sherwood Forest is at Park Regency listed at $650.
How much is the average rent for a Gated Sherwood Forest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Sherwood Forest is $1,182.
What is the largest Gated Sherwood Forest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Sherwood Forest is a 1,410 square feet unit starting from $1,526 at The Waters At Millerville.
What is the average size for Sherwood Forest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in Sherwood Forest is currently at 690 sq ft.
